Also, check the following tips to conserve battery life:

 

  • Turn off All-Day Sync in the Fitbit app because it increases battery drain on both your tracker and phone:
  1. From the Fitbit app dashboard, tap or click the Account icon > your device image.
  2. Find the option to turn off All-Day Sync.
  • (Android only) Turn off the Always Connected setting. Similar to All-Day Sync, it can reduce battery life.
  • If you have many silent alarms set, consider deleting some. Each alarm you add up to the maximum of 8 reduces battery life by a small percentage. 
  • Don't charge your tracker in extreme heat or cold.
